Cloud Defense Logo

Products

Solutions

Company

Book A Live Demo

CVE-2023-5666 Explained : Impact and Mitigation

Learn about CVE-2023-5666 affecting WordPress Accordion plugin up to version 2.6, allowing attackers to execute arbitrary scripts. Update to secure version and monitor for malicious activity.

This CVE-2023-5666, assigned by Wordfence, was published on October 30, 2023. The vulnerability affects the "Accordion" plugin for WordPress versions up to 2.6, allowing for Stored Cross-Site Scripting attacks.

Understanding CVE-2023-5666

This section will delve into the specifics of CVE-2023-5666, outlining its nature and impact.

What is CVE-2023-5666?

The CVE-2023-5666 vulnerability is a Stored Cross-Site Scripting issue within the "Accordion" WordPress plugin. It stems from inadequate input sanitization and output escaping on user-supplied attributes, enabling authenticated attackers with contributor-level permissions or higher to inject malicious scripts into pages.

The Impact of CVE-2023-5666

The impact of this vulnerability is significant as it allows attackers to execute arbitrary scripts on compromised pages, potentially leading to further attacks or unauthorized actions.

Technical Details of CVE-2023-5666

In this section, we will explore the technical aspects of CVE-2023-5666, including the vulnerability description, affected systems, and the exploitation mechanism.

Vulnerability Description

The vulnerability arises due to insufficient input sanitization and output escaping, enabling attackers to inject malicious scripts via the 'tcpaccordion' shortcode in the "Accordion" plugin for WordPress versions up to 2.6.

Affected Systems and Versions

The "Accordion" plugin for WordPress versions up to and including 2.6 are susceptible to this Stored Cross-Site Scripting vulnerability.

Exploitation Mechanism

Authenticated attackers with contributor-level permissions or above can leverage this vulnerability to insert and execute arbitrary web scripts on compromised pages, posing a security risk to website visitors.

Mitigation and Prevention

In this section, we will discuss the necessary steps to mitigate and prevent exploitation of CVE-2023-5666.

Immediate Steps to Take

Website administrators are advised to update the "Accordion" plugin to a secure version (beyond 2.6) and closely monitor the affected pages for any signs of malicious activity. Additionally, restricting contributor-level permissions can help reduce the risk of exploitation.

Long-Term Security Practices

Implementing robust input validation and output escaping mechanisms in plugin development can help prevent similar vulnerabilities in the future. Regular security audits and user input validation are also recommended to ensure website integrity.

Patching and Updates

Staying informed about security patches released by the plugin vendor and promptly applying updates is crucial to addressing known vulnerabilities like CVE-2023-5666. Regularly updating all plugins and maintaining a proactive security posture are essential practices to safeguard against potential threats.

Popular CVEs

CVE Id

Published Date

Is your System Free of Underlying Vulnerabilities?
Find Out Now